Etymology
From over- + dye.
verb
- To dye (something already coloured) with another colour.“To last more than a few days in the sunshine, the crushed logwood needed to be over-dyed on woad- or indigo-coloured fabric.”
- To dye too much.“Near-synonym: overcolor”
